diff --git a/packages/app/package.json b/packages/app/package.json index 7c7c7347f4..f17e890678 100644 --- a/packages/app/package.json +++ b/packages/app/package.json @@ -54,24 +54,24 @@ "@shopify/cli-kit": "3.72.0", "@shopify/function-runner": "4.1.1", "@shopify/plugin-cloudflare": "3.72.0", - "@shopify/polaris": "12.10.0", - "@shopify/polaris-icons": "8.0.0", + "@shopify/polaris": "12.27.0", + "@shopify/polaris-icons": "8.11.1", "@shopify/theme": "3.72.0", - "@shopify/theme-check-node": "3.4.0", - "body-parser": "1.20.2", + "@shopify/theme-check-node": "3.5.0", + "body-parser": "1.20.3", "camelcase-keys": "9.1.3", - "chokidar": "3.5.3", - "diff": "5.1.0", + "chokidar": "3.6.0", + "diff": "5.2.0", "esbuild": "0.24.0", - "express": "4.19.2", + "express": "4.21.2", "graphql-request": "5.2.0", - "h3": "0.7.21", + "h3": "0.8.6", "http-proxy": "1.18.1", "ignore": "6.0.2", "proper-lockfile": "4.1.2", "react": "^18.2.0", - "react-dom": "18.2.0", - "ws": "8.13.0" + "react-dom": "18.3.1", + "ws": "8.18.0" }, "devDependencies": { "@types/body-parser": "^1.19.2", @@ -82,7 +82,7 @@ "@types/proper-lockfile": "4.1.4", "@types/react": "18.2.0", "@types/react-dom": "18.2.0", - "@types/ws": "^8.5.5", + "@types/ws": "^8.5.13", "@vitest/coverage-istanbul": "^1.6.0", "graphql": "^16.8.1", "graphql-tag": "^2.12.6" diff --git a/packages/cli-kit/package.json b/packages/cli-kit/package.json index 0a27f8d7e1..dc5589f17a 100644 --- a/packages/cli-kit/package.json +++ b/packages/cli-kit/package.json @@ -101,66 +101,66 @@ ] }, "dependencies": { - "@apidevtools/json-schema-ref-parser": "11.6.4", - "@bugsnag/js": "7.21.0", + "@apidevtools/json-schema-ref-parser": "11.7.3", + "@bugsnag/js": "7.25.0", "@graphql-typed-document-node/core": "3.2.0", "@iarna/toml": "2.2.5", "@oclif/core": "3.26.5", - "@opentelemetry/api": "1.6.0", - "@opentelemetry/core": "1.17.1", - "@opentelemetry/exporter-metrics-otlp-http": "0.43.0", - "@opentelemetry/resources": "1.17.1", - "@opentelemetry/sdk-metrics": "1.17.1", - "@opentelemetry/semantic-conventions": "1.17.1", + "@opentelemetry/api": "1.9.0", + "@opentelemetry/core": "1.30.0", + "@opentelemetry/exporter-metrics-otlp-http": "0.57.0", + "@opentelemetry/resources": "1.30.0", + "@opentelemetry/sdk-metrics": "1.30.0", + "@opentelemetry/semantic-conventions": "1.28.0", "@types/archiver": "5.3.2", - "ajv": "8.13.0", - "ansi-escapes": "6.2.0", + "ajv": "8.17.1", + "ansi-escapes": "6.2.1", "archiver": "5.3.2", "bottleneck": "2.19.5", - "chalk": "5.3.0", + "chalk": "5.4.1", "change-case": "4.1.2", "color-json": "3.0.5", "commondir": "1.0.1", "conf": "11.0.2", "deepmerge": "4.3.1", "del": "6.1.1", - "dotenv": "16.4.5", + "dotenv": "16.4.7", "env-paths": "3.0.0", "execa": "7.2.0", - "fast-glob": "3.3.1", + "fast-glob": "3.3.2", "figures": "5.0.0", "find-up": "6.3.0", - "form-data": "4.0.0", + "form-data": "4.0.1", "fs-extra": "11.1.0", - "get-port-please": "3.0.1", + "get-port-please": "3.1.2", "gradient-string": "2.0.2", "graphql": "16.8.1", "graphql-request": "5.2.0", "ink": "4.4.1", "is-interactive": "2.0.0", - "jose": "5.8.0", + "jose": "5.9.6", "latest-version": "7.0.0", - "liquidjs": "10.9.2", + "liquidjs": "10.19.1", "lodash": "4.17.21", "macaddress": "0.5.3", - "minimatch": "9.0.3", + "minimatch": "9.0.5", "mrmime": "1.0.1", "network-interfaces": "1.1.0", "node-abort-controller": "3.1.1", "node-fetch": "3.3.2", "open": "8.4.2", - "pathe": "1.1.1", + "pathe": "1.1.2", "react": "^18.2.0", - "semver": "7.5.4", - "simple-git": "3.19.1", + "semver": "7.6.3", + "simple-git": "3.27.0", "stacktracey": "2.1.8", "strip-ansi": "7.1.0", "supports-hyperlinks": "3.1.0", - "tempy": "3.0.0", + "tempy": "3.1.0", "terminal-link": "3.0.0", "ts-error": "1.0.6", "which": "4.0.0", - "zod": "3.22.3" + "zod": "3.24.1" }, "devDependencies": { "@types/commondir": "^1.0.0", diff --git a/packages/cli/package.json b/packages/cli/package.json index 8cce6f3c2a..2d65a3b36c 100644 --- a/packages/cli/package.json +++ b/packages/cli/package.json @@ -101,7 +101,7 @@ ] }, "dependencies": { - "@ast-grep/napi": "0.11.0", + "@ast-grep/napi": "0.32.2", "esbuild": "0.24.0" }, "devDependencies": { diff --git a/packages/eslint-plugin-cli/package.json b/packages/eslint-plugin-cli/package.json index a4508463c7..a858d8eb20 100644 --- a/packages/eslint-plugin-cli/package.json +++ b/packages/eslint-plugin-cli/package.json @@ -18,20 +18,20 @@ "@babel/core": "7.23.5", "@shopify/eslint-plugin": "42.1.0", "@typescript-eslint/eslint-plugin": "7.13.1", - "@typescript-eslint/parser": "7.13.1", + "@typescript-eslint/parser": "7.18.0", "eslint-config-prettier": "8.10.0", - "eslint-plugin-import": "2.28.0", - "eslint-plugin-jsdoc": "48.2.12", - "eslint-plugin-jsx-a11y": "6.7.1", + "eslint-plugin-import": "2.31.0", + "eslint-plugin-jsdoc": "48.11.0", + "eslint-plugin-jsx-a11y": "6.10.2", "eslint-plugin-no-catch-all": "1.1.0", "eslint-plugin-prettier": "4.2.1", - "eslint-plugin-react": "7.33.2", - "eslint-plugin-react-hooks": "4.6.0", - "eslint-plugin-tsdoc": "0.2.17", + "eslint-plugin-react": "7.37.2", + "eslint-plugin-react-hooks": "4.6.2", + "eslint-plugin-tsdoc": "0.4.0", "eslint-plugin-unused-imports": "3.2.0", - "eslint-plugin-vitest": "0.2.8", + "eslint-plugin-vitest": "0.5.4", "execa": "7.2.0", - "debug": "4.3.4" + "debug": "4.4.0" }, "devDependencies": { "typescript": "5.2.2", diff --git a/packages/theme/package.json b/packages/theme/package.json index d65d291355..80397cf64c 100644 --- a/packages/theme/package.json +++ b/packages/theme/package.json @@ -43,11 +43,11 @@ "dependencies": { "@oclif/core": "3.26.5", "@shopify/cli-kit": "3.72.0", - "@shopify/theme-check-node": "3.4.0", - "@shopify/theme-language-server-node": "2.3.2", - "chokidar": "3.5.3", - "h3": "1.12.0", - "yaml": "2.3.2" + "@shopify/theme-check-node": "3.5.0", + "@shopify/theme-language-server-node": "2.3.3", + "chokidar": "3.6.0", + "h3": "1.13.0", + "yaml": "2.6.1" }, "devDependencies": { "@types/node": "18.19.3",